CSCS Exercise Technique, Program Design,
Organization/Administration UPDATED
ACTUAL Exam Questions and CORRECT
Answers
The athlete should maximize which of the following when performing this exercise? (ex= Cycled
Split Squat jump)
a. leg (knee) flexion
b. jump height

c. shoulder extension - CORRECT ANSWER - b. jump height


Which of the following cues is most appropriate to provide this athlete? (ex= Barbell upright
row)
a. "Continue with current technique."
b. "Widen the hand grip."

c. "Narrow the foot stance" - CORRECT ANSWER - a. "Continue with current
technique."


Which of the following cues is most appropriate to provide this athlete? (ex= step up w/ barbell,
client never fully gets foot on box during step up)
a. "Place the entire foot on top of the box."
b. "Push off vigorously with the trailing foot."

c. "Continue with current technique." - CORRECT ANSWER - a. "Place the entire foot on
top of the box."


Which of the following cues is most appropriate while performing the exercise as shown? (ex=
Perfect bent over row w/ barbell)
a. "Allow the bar to descend faster."
b. "Extend the knees."

,c. "Continue with current technique." - CORRECT ANSWER - c. "Continue with current
technique."


Which of the following handgrips is most appropriate when performing this exercise? (Ex= Flat
dumbbell bench press)
a. pronated, closed
b. supinated, open

c. pronated, open - CORRECT ANSWER - a. pronated, closed


Which of the following handgrips is used for this exercise? (Ex= Flat dumbbell fly)
a. neutral
b. supinated

c. pronated - CORRECT ANSWER - a. neutral


Which of the following recommendations should be given to the athlete performing this
exercise? (Ex= Multiple forward jumps over cones)
a. increase leg (knee) flexion on foot contact
b. decrease the arm swing

c. continue with current technique - CORRECT ANSWER - c. continue with current
technique


Which of the following recommendations is most appropriate when performing this exercise?
(Ex= Sprint Resistance w/ belt)
a. a longer bungee cord should be used
b. the rear athlete should lean forward

c. continue with current technique - CORRECT ANSWER - c. continue with current
technique


Which of the following is the most appropriate recommendation for the spotter? (Ex= Dumbbell
chest press with spotters hand on the elbow of the lifter)

, a. position the hands near the lifter's wrists
b. position the hands on the dumbbells

c. continue with current technique - CORRECT ANSWER - a. position the hands near the
lifter's wrists


Which of the following recommendations should be given to the athlete performing this
exercise? (Ex. Hip Sled machine)
a. turn the toes slightly outward
b. lower the feet on the platform

c. place the feet hip width apart - CORRECT ANSWER - a. turn the toes slightly outward


Which of the following recommendations is most appropriate to provide this athlete? (Ex. Flat
machine Hamstring curl)
a. plantar flex the feet while lowering the load
b. position the head toward a neutral position

c. extend the back while raising the load - CORRECT ANSWER - b. position the head
toward a neutral position


Which of the following recommendations should be given to the spotter? Spotter was behind
athlete with hands ready to spot above hips (Ex. Forward step lunge w/ barbell)
a. stand closer to the athlete
b. spot the barbell

c. continue with current technique - CORRECT ANSWER - c. continue with current
technique
